From owner-freebsd-bugs@FreeBSD.ORG Mon Nov 4 01:20:00 2013 Return-Path: Delivered-To: freebsd-bugs@smarthost.ysv.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[8.8.178.115]) (using TLSv1 with cipher ADH-AES256-SHA (256/256 bits)) (No client certificate requested) by hub.freebsd.org (Postfix) with ESMTP id 96EC6A70 for ; Mon, 4 Nov 2013 01:20:00 +0000 (UTC) (envelope-from gnats@FreeBSD.org) Received: from freefall.freebsd.org (freefall.freebsd.org [IPv6:2001:1900:2254:206c::16:87]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mx1.freebsd.org (Postfix) with ESMTPS id 73CE32E46 for ; Mon, 4 Nov 2013 01:20:00 +0000 (UTC) Received: from freefall.freebsd.org (localhost [127.0.0.1]) by freefall.freebsd.org (8.14.7/8.14.7) with ESMTP id rA41K05s006679 for ; Mon, 4 Nov 2013 01:20:00 GMT (envelope-from gnats@freefall.freebsd.org) Received: (from gnats@localhost) by freefall.freebsd.org (8.14.7/8.14.7/Submit) id rA41K06a006678; Mon, 4 Nov 2013 01:20:00 GMT (envelope-from gnats) Resent-Date: Mon, 4 Nov 2013 01:20:00 GMT Resent-Message-Id: <201311040120.rA41K06a006678@freefall.freebsd.org> Resent-From: FreeBSD-gnats-submit@FreeBSD.org (GNATS Filer) Resent-To: freebsd-bugs@FreeBSD.org Resent-Reply-To: FreeBSD-gnats-submit@FreeBSD.org, adrian chadd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:1900:2254:206a::19:1]) (using TLSv1 with cipher ADH-AES256-SHA (256/256 bits)) (No client certificate requested) by hub.freebsd.org (Postfix) with ESMTP id C1B589A6 for ; Mon, 4 Nov 2013 01:14:43 +0000 (UTC) (envelope-from nobody@FreeBSD.org) Received: from oldred.freebsd.org (oldred.freebsd.org [8.8.178.121]) (using TLSv1 with cipher DHE-RSA-AES256-SHA (256/256 bits)) (No client certificate requested) by mx1.freebsd.org (Postfix) with ESMTPS id AFCA72E17 for ; Mon, 4 Nov 2013 01:14:43 +0000 (UTC) Received: from oldred.freebsd.org ([127.0.1.6]) by oldred.freebsd.org (8.14.5/8.14.7) with ESMTP id rA41Eh0O094544 for ; Mon, 4 Nov 2013 01:14:43 GMT (envelope-from nobody@oldred.freebsd.org) Received: (from nobody@localhost) by oldred.freebsd.org (8.14.5/8.14.5/Submit) id rA41Ehc0094541; Mon, 4 Nov 2013 01:14:43 GMT (envelope-from nobody) Message-Id: <201311040114.rA41Ehc0094541@oldred.freebsd.org> Date: Mon, 4 Nov 2013 01:14:43 GMT From: adrian chadd To: freebsd-gnats-submit@FreeBSD.org X-Send-Pr-Version: www-3.1 Subject: misc/183645: [chrome] segfault in string operations X-BeenThere: freebsd-bugs@freebsd.org X-Mailman-Version: 2.1.14 Precedence: list List-Id: Bug reports List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 04 Nov 2013 01:20:00 -0000 >Number: 183645 >Category: misc >Synopsis: [chrome] segfault in string operations >Confidential: no >Severity: non-critical >Priority: low >Responsible: freebsd-bugs >State: open >Quarter: >Keywords: >Date-Required: >Class: sw-bug >Submitter-Id: current-users >Arrival-Date: Mon Nov 04 01:20:00 UTC 2013 >Closed-Date: >Last-Modified: >Originator: adrian chadd >Release: 11-CURRENT i386 >Organization: >Environment: FreeBSD lucy-11i386 11.0-CURRENT FreeBSD 11.0-CURRENT #1 r257371M: Wed Oct 30 20:09:48 PDT 2013 adrian@lucy-11i386:/usr/home/adrian/work/freebsd/head/obj/usr/home/adrian/work/freebsd/head/src/sys/LUCY_11_i386 i386 >Description: This happened! :( I'm not sure whether it's a bug in chrome, or in our C++ library, or compiler, or what. Please let me know what extra debugging information I can provide. Thanks! -adrian adrian@lucy-11i386:~ % pkg info | grep chromium chromium-30.0.1599.101 Mostly BSD-licensed web browser based on WebKit and Gtk+ (gdb) bt #0 0x2d7d47ae in memcpy () from /lib/libc.so.7 #1 0x2d649454 in std::__1::basic_string, std::__1::allocator >::basic_s tring () from /usr/lib/libc++.so.1 #2 0x085f19e7 in ChromeMain () #3 0x08503527 in ChromeMain () #4 0x0a029c4d in utrie2_swap_46 () #5 0x0a02943a in utrie2_swap_46 () #6 0x0a0291df in utrie2_swap_46 () #7 0x0a027276 in utrie2_swap_46 () #8 0x08f3a15f in ChromeMain () #9 0x08e47efb in ChromeMain () #10 0x08e1be5f in ChromeMain () #11 0x08e4a55e in ChromeMain () #12 0x08e1c3a3 in ChromeMain () #13 0x08e1cf7b in ChromeMain () #14 0x08e1a95c in ChromeMain () #15 0x2ca838a1 in gtk_marshal_VOID__UINT_STRING () from /usr/local/lib/libgtk-x11-2.0.so.0 #16 0x2c8061fe in g_closure_invoke () from /usr/local/lib/libgobject-2.0.so.0 #17 0x2c81b72c in signal_emit_unlocked_R () from /usr/local/lib/libgobject-2.0.so.0 #18 0x2c81c3de in g_signal_emit_valist () from /usr/local/lib/libgobject-2.0.so.0 #19 0x2c81cc06 in g_signal_emit () from /usr/local/lib/libgobject-2.0.so.0 #20 0x2cbc4002 in gtk_widget_event () from /usr/local/lib/libgtk-x11-2.0.so.0 #21 0x2cbc3cf7 in gtk_widget_event () from /usr/local/lib/libgtk-x11-2.0.so.0 #22 0x2cbd68c7 in gtk_window_propagate_key_event () from /usr/local/lib/libgtk-x11-2.0.so.0 #23 0x08ddca99 in ChromeMain () #24 0x08ddbe1c in ChromeMain () #25 0x2ca838a1 in gtk_marshal_VOID__UINT_STRING () from /usr/local/lib/libgtk-x11-2.0.so.0 #26 0x2c8061fe in g_closure_invoke () from /usr/local/lib/libgobject-2.0.so.0 #27 0x2c81b72c in signal_emit_unlocked_R () from /usr/local/lib/libgobject-2.0.so.0 #28 0x2c81c3de in g_signal_emit_valist () from /usr/local/lib/libgobject-2.0.so.0 #29 0x2c81cc06 in g_signal_emit () from /usr/local/lib/libgobject-2.0.so.0 #30 0x2cbc4002 in gtk_widget_event () from /usr/local/lib/libgtk-x11-2.0.so.0 #31 0x2cbc3cf7 in gtk_widget_event () from /usr/local/lib/libgtk-x11-2.0.so.0 #32 0x2ca814bb in gtk_propagate_event () from /usr/local/lib/libgtk-x11-2.0.so.0 #33 0x2ca8113e in gtk_main_do_event () from /usr/local/lib/libgtk-x11-2.0.so.0 #34 0x09293394 in ChromeMain () #35 0x2cda241b in gdk_screen_get_setting () from /usr/local/lib/libgdk-x11-2.0.so.0 #36 0x2c88abea in g_main_context_dispatch () from /usr/local/lib/libglib-2.0.so.0 ---Type to continue, or q to quit--- #37 0x2c88b00e in g_main_context_iterate () from /usr/local/lib/libglib-2.0.so.0 #38 0x2c88b09d in g_main_context_iteration () from /usr/local/lib/libglib-2.0.so.0 #39 0x092f8e58 in ChromeMain () #40 0x092f91bd in ChromeMain () #41 0x092ba176 in ChromeMain () #42 0x092d0cae in ChromeMain () #43 0x083b0e77 in ChromeMain () #44 0x0892c1db in ChromeMain () #45 0x08a55940 in ChromeMain () #46 0x0a4ff693 in utrie2_swap_46 () #47 0x08b51496 in ChromeMain () #48 0x08b50a4d in ChromeMain () #49 0x08075a4d in ChromeMain () #50 0x0807593a in ?? () #51 0x00000001 in ?? () #52 0xbfbfdcb0 in ?? () #53 0xbfbfdcb8 in ?? () #54 0xbfbfdcb8 in ?? () #55 0xbfbfdcac in ?? () #56 0x00000000 in ?? () (gdb) >How-To-Repeat: >Fix: >Release-Note: >Audit-Trail: >Unformatted: